< 返回版块

chinagxwei 发表于 2020-07-23 15:23

同样的代码,在linux下正常运行。在windows下会出现并发阻塞,无错误提示只是运行请求到一半就卡住了。这个算是bug还是正常现象?

评论区

写评论
作者 chinagxwei 2020-07-23 23:32

多谢,好像测试数据库确实是5.5,明天升级一下看看。

--
👇
adminSxs: rbatis我遇到过这个问题,原因是我用的mariadb 5.5,我升级了版本就正常了

adminSxs 2020-07-23 20:56

rbatis我遇到过这个问题,原因是我用的mariadb 5.5,我升级了版本就正常了

作者 chinagxwei 2020-07-23 17:39

sqlx和rbiats都有。数据并发入库的时候,join_all等待异步线程完成时,最后一个异步线程在win下就阻塞了,linux没有这个情况。但是也有可能是mysql的问题,线上linux的运行程序并没有这个问题,所以很奇怪。

--
👇
Mike Tang: 库的bug吧,用的什么。

Mike Tang 2020-07-23 16:07

库的bug吧,用的什么。

1 共 4 条评论, 1 页